"Is the fine art of living going out of style?"

This 1926 Van Sweringen Company advertisement compares the "whirl and turmoil" and "the roar and trampling rush of city traffic" to the "restful, peaceful atmosphere" of Shaker Heights, where there is "riding, boating, tennis, and golf at our very doors" and "working in our gardens and walking out into the countryside" keeps residents healthy and happy. | Source: Cleveland State University Library Special Collections
